I've read that the widths of .22lr and .22 Mag bulletsare different. If this is true, would the difference effect the accuracy of a dual cylinder gun like a Single Six?
 
That's correct. Nominal bore diameter for a .22 is 0.223, but for the .22 Mag. it's .224. My understanding is that the convertible guns have the larger bore diameter. I doubt that it would have much effect on accuracy, but don't recall ever seeing a real good test to prove that one way or the other.
